More about Habso 

Habso was born in a Kenyan refugee camp and was fortunate enough to emigrate to the United States when she was 9 years old. She is an active, vibrant, and curious individual with an enigmatic personality that helps her captivate, inspire, and influence her audiences.

Habso focuses on mental health, identity and representation. Her storytelling is globally recognized for her innovative approach to fostering relationships across lines of differences and breaking barriers. She has told stories through different mediums, ranging from radio to television interviews and print media, to raise awareness about diversity,access, equity, and inclusion. She firmly stands up for all children who have become marginalized in the educational system.

Currently, Habso is actively voicing her concerns about standard exclusions faced in public education, specifically how immigrants and refugees experience exclusion. Habso is an example of what is possible when we say yes to a child.
